Recent trend shows that Indian students are opting for international universities to pursue their higher education in non-traditional courses like robotics, applied science or artificial intelligence along with sports management, music technology, photonics and image consulting. With the availability of education loan for these off-beat and non-traditional courses, this has made it more convenient for aspirants to study abroad.
Although India has a few universities and educational institutions offering some of these courses, they are quite new and have a long way to reach global standards. There are many renowned educational institutions— Universities in Europe and the United States
Neeraj Saxena, CEO and MD, Auxilo Finserv Pvt Ltd, said: “Earlier, educational loans were available only for certain professional courses. Staying abreast with the changing trends, many loan providers provide students with an education loan for studying courses like robotics, sports management or music technology. This has led to the rise in the number of Indian students aspiring to pursue off-beat courses from international educational institutions.”
